5. Radio Broadcasts

For those who prefer a more traditional approach, tuning into radio broadcasts is an excellent way to follow the Dodgers scores live. AM 570 LA Sports is the official radio home of the Dodgers, providing live play-by-play coverage of every game. Listening to the radio allows you to stay connected to the action while multitasking, whether you're driving, working, or doing household chores. The radio commentators offer detailed descriptions of the game, painting a vivid picture in your mind and bringing the excitement to life. This method is also perfect for fans who enjoy the nostalgia of listening to baseball on the radio, a tradition that dates back to the early days of the sport. Key Stats and Insights to Follow

Beyond just the score, there's a wealth of data and insights that can enhance your understanding and enjoyment of the game. Keeping an eye on key stats can provide a deeper appreciation for the nuances of baseball and the Dodgers' performance. Let's explore some of the most important metrics to follow.

Batting Average

Batting average is a classic statistic that measures a player's success at the plate. It’s calculated by dividing the number of hits by the number of at-bats. A high batting average indicates that a player is consistently getting hits, making them a valuable asset to the team. For the Dodgers, tracking the batting averages of key players like Mookie Betts and Freddie Freeman can give you a sense of their offensive contributions. While batting average doesn't tell the whole story, it's a good starting point for evaluating a player's hitting prowess. It's a straightforward stat that fans of all levels can easily understand and appreciate.

ERA (Earned Run Average)

On the pitching side, ERA (Earned Run Average) is a crucial statistic. It measures the number of earned runs a pitcher allows per nine innings pitched. A lower ERA indicates that a pitcher is more effective at preventing runs, making it a key metric for evaluating pitching performance. For the Dodgers, starting pitchers like Clayton Kershaw and Walker Buehler are judged heavily on their ERAs. Tracking this stat allows you to assess the consistency and reliability of the team's pitching staff. A strong pitching rotation with low ERAs is often a hallmark of a successful baseball team. ERA provides valuable insights into a pitcher's ability to control the game and keep the opposition from scoring.
